The Top 9 Habits to Eliminate

1. Procrastination

Putting off tasks until the last minute increases stress and reduces the quality of your work. Instead, break tasks into smaller steps and tackle them one at a time.

2. Negative Self-Talk

Constantly criticizing yourself undermines confidence. Replace negative thoughts with affirmations and focus on your strengths.

3. Excessive Screen Time

Spending too much time on screens can lead to mental fatigue and poor sleep. Set limits and take regular breaks to recharge.

4. Skipping Meals

Ignoring hunger signals harms your metabolism and energy levels. Prioritize balanced meals to fuel your body and mind.

5. Overcommitting

Saying “yes” to everything leads to burnout. Learn to set boundaries and prioritize your well-being.

6. Multitasking

Juggling multiple tasks reduces efficiency and increases errors. Focus on one task at a time for better results.

7. Comparing Yourself to Others

This habit breeds dissatisfaction. Celebrate your unique journey and progress instead.

8. Poor Sleep Hygiene

Inconsistent sleep patterns affect mood and cognitive function. Establish a bedtime routine for better rest.

9. Holding Grudges

Resentment weighs you down emotionally. Practice forgiveness to free yourself from negativity.
